What is the Fire Hydrant strain?

Fire Hydrant is a indica cannabis strain with up to 24.0% THC, known for its relaxed effects and diesel and earthy flavor profile.

Fire Hydrant is a relatively rare indica-dominant hybrid cannabis strain that emerged in the early 2010s from the Pacific Northwest region of the United States. The strain's exact origins are somewhat obscure, with limited documentation available about its initial development. Breeders reportedly created Fire Hydrant by crossing two potent indica strains to produce a heavy-hitting, physically sedative variety. The name likely references both the strain's powerful effects and its distinctive appearance, with dense, compact buds that some users describe as resembling fire hydrants in their stout structure.

The strain is characterized by its exceptionally dense, chunky buds that are typically dark green with occasional purple hues, covered in a thick layer of frosty trichomes and vibrant orange pistils. Fire Hydrant's aroma profile is complex, combining earthy, woody notes with subtle hints of diesel and spice. When properly cured, the buds emit a pungent scent that intensifies when broken apart or ground. The flavor follows a similar pattern, with earthy, woody notes dominating the initial taste, followed by subtle spicy and diesel undertones on the exhale.

Fire Hydrant is known among cannabis enthusiasts for its exceptionally potent sedative effects that come on quickly and build in intensity. The strain has gained a reputation for being particularly effective for evening or nighttime use due to its strong body-focused effects. While not as widely available as more commercial strains, Fire Hydrant has maintained a dedicated following among indica enthusiasts who seek deeply relaxing, physically sedating effects. The strain's rarity means it's primarily found in specific regional markets rather than being widely distributed nationally or internationally.

How do you grow Fire Hydrant?

Fire Hydrant is considered a moderately difficult strain to cultivate, best suited for experienced growers. The plants typically have a flowering time of 8-9 weeks indoors and are ready for harvest by late September to early October outdoors. Indoor yields are moderate, averaging 400-500 grams per square meter, while outdoor plants can produce 500-600 grams per plant under optimal conditions. The strain prefers a controlled indoor environment but can also be grown outdoors in warm, Mediterranean-like climates with consistent temperatures. Plants tend to remain relatively short and bushy, typically reaching 90-120 cm indoors and 120-150 cm outdoors, with a strong indica structure. Special considerations include maintaining proper humidity control during flowering to prevent mold due to the dense bud structure, and providing adequate support for branches as the heavy buds develop. The plants respond well to training techniques like topping and low-stress training to maximize yield.
